There are several key issues and items that should be considered when you are implementing a S&T vision. These are articulated as you develop the S&T school plan. They include:

  • curriculum planning and monitoring
  • reporting student achievement
  • the unique role of the S&T KLA in students’ development of Information and Communication Technology capabilities
  • activities involving parents and the community
  • ways in which records could be shared and stored
  • role of the library as a learning resource centre
  • ways in which equipment and materials are maintained and stored
  • budget allocation
  • professional development.

Think about the vision statement that has been reviewed and accepted by your school community.

Identify any differences between the ways that S&T is currently represented in the curriculum of the school, and the changes that may be required to achieve the vision. The aim should be:

confirm S&T as having priority in the school experience of all students

provide structures and guidance that assist all teachers to provide a coherent S&T program for their class.
